    I love Luna moths. Fun fact, they don’t have any mouthparts or a digestive system. They do not eat during their adult phase. They usually live for just one week.

      Because i love this kind of stupid joke. Here is the etymology of entomology

      “the branch of zoology which treats of insects,” 1764, from French entomologie (1764), coined from -logie “study of” (see -logy) + Greek entomon “insect,” neuter of entomos “cut in pieces, cut up,” in this case “having a notch or cut (at the waist),” from en “in” (see en- (2)) + temnein “to cut” (from PIE root *tem- “to cut”).
